Transaction effd41638420002a3a371aea2d448784930412faae1e2c669e74b736873b759e
1 Input
1 Output
-
effd41638420002a3a371aea2d448784930412faae1e2c669e74b736873b759e:0
- value
- 6289928
- script pubkey
- OP_0 OP_PUSHBYTES_20 17efe6411a7b9de5c4b4779e6cf4a7f09260d49d
- address
- bc1qzlh7vsg60ww7t395w70xea987zfxp4yakqvc93